1962 AC Aceca vs. 2008 BMW 525

To start off, 2008 BMW 525 is newer by 46 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1962 AC Aceca.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1962 AC Aceca would be higher. At 2,553 cc (6 cylinders), 1962 AC Aceca is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 BMW 525 weights approximately 889 kg more than 1962 AC Aceca.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 BMW 525 (245 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 36 more torque (in Nm) than 1962 AC Aceca. (209 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 2008 BMW 525 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1962 AC Aceca.
